From fba7c1874d61cd0b5fec3d893e2964bc4b1f8a8e Mon Sep 17 00:00:00 2001 From: Pino Toscano Date: Fri, 18 May 2007 22:07:33 +0000 Subject: [PATCH] give the # title for a new bookmark instead of # svn path=/trunk/KDE/kdegraphics/okular/; revision=666142 --- core/bookmarkmanager.cpp |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/core/bookmarkmanager.cpp b/core/bookmarkmanager.cpp index 5a2bfa817..99ceadf96 100644 --- a/core/bookmarkmanager.cpp +++ b/core/bookmarkmanager.cpp @@ -283,13 +283,11 @@ bool BookmarkManager::setPageBookmark( int page ) bool found = false; bool added = false; - int count = 0; for ( KBookmark bm = it.value().first(); !found && !bm.isNull(); bm = it.value().next( bm ) ) { if ( bm.isSeparator() || bm.isGroup() ) continue; - ++count; DocumentViewport vp( bm.url().htmlRef() ); if ( vp.isValid() && vp.pageNumber == page ) found = true; @@ -305,7 +303,7 @@ bool BookmarkManager::setPageBookmark( int page ) vp.rePos.normalizedY = 0; KUrl newurl = d->url; newurl.setHTMLRef( vp.toString() ); - it.value().addBookmark( d->manager, QString( "#%1" ).arg( count + 1 ), newurl, QString(), false ); + it.value().addBookmark( d->manager, QString::fromLatin1( "#" ) + QString::number( vp.pageNumber + 1 ), newurl, QString(), false ); added = true; } return added;